I'd like to hear your thoughts on a planned #homeserver upgrade. Current set up is a Dual Xeon E5-2470 v2, running a NAS and multiple VMs under #NetBSD 10.

A 2U rackmount case is available.

Two M.2 slots and ECC RAM are hard requirements, AMD is preferred.

My currently favoured options:
- Asrock Rack X570D4U + Ryzen 9 5950X
- Asrock Rack B650D4U + Ryzen 9 9950X or 9900X
- Asrock Rack B650D4U + EPYC 4564P or 4584PX

The 9950X and the 4564P seem to be almost identical performance-wise, so I'm not quite sure what the advantage of the EPYC is.

Cooling 170 W TDP (4564P and 9950X) in 2U may not be trivial. The 4584PX has more cache, but lower single-thread performance, and also lower TDP, but is slightly more expensive, though all are within my budget.

Single-core-Performance is nice for some of my applications, but multiple cores are useful for running up to 6 parallel VMs.

#AMD #EPYC #4565P & #4585PX #Benchmarks Against #Xeon #6369P
For "conventional" #server workloads like web serving and databases, the EPYC 4005 series dominates.
With up to 16C/32TH, #AVX512, DDR5-5600 memory and other advantages, the EPYC 4005 series is the very easy answer for those that may be looking for affordable #HPC
The AMD #EPYC4005 series #CPU deliver excellent generational uplift over the EPYC 4004 series and outright obliterating the #Xeon6300 series

#Intel's #ClearLinux Demonstrates Software Optimization Benefits On #AMD #EPYC 9005 Series
Clear #Linux easily took top spot. Clear was 6% faster than Ubuntu 25.04, which was running with the "performance" governor like the rest. Or compared to Ubuntu 24.04 LTS, the in-house Intel distribution was 23% faster. Ubuntu and other Linux distributions continue moving performance in right direction but Intel's Clear continues to deliver the fastest out-of-the-box x86_64 Linux.

SMT Remains Very Advantageous For #Zen5 #AMD #EPYC Performance
#SMT typically was of measurable benefit to the 5th Gen AMD EPYC processor with the exception of some #HPC workloads that perform better with SMT disabled or otherwise limited by memory bandwidth. SMT also hurt the OpenVINO inference latency but by and large Simultaneous Multi-Threading remains an important and valuable feature for AMD processors.

The Compelling #AVX512 Performance Advantage On #AMD #EPYC 9005 "Turin"
Workloads tested on this #EPYC9655 Supermicro server, with AVX-512 yielded 1.57x the performance of the same hardware/software but with AVX-512 forced off.
